Baby and Toddler Constipation remedy

My toddler has constipation issues.  Mostly, its because he squeezes and does not let it come out!
Dr. Sears says it takes two months or more to get over the constipation cycle.
Here is a daily regimen that is extremely nutritious and will help with constipation:

Organic applesauce
apricot (fruit, sauce or juice)
Coconut oil (about a tablespoon)
flaxseed oil or ground flax seeds (couple of teaspoons)

He eats this for breakfast, and then throughout the day as a snack between meals until the cup is finished by the end of the day.
